Health minister urges men to seek early prostate cancer screening

Summary by Cyprus Mail
Health Minister Neophytos Charalambides called on men to seek medical advice on prostate cancer screening. Speaking at the Europa Uomo event marking European prostate cancer awareness day on Tuesday, Charalambides said prostate cancer remained “accompanied by embarrassment, fear, or the belief that visiting the doctor and discussing appropriate screening can wait.” He said gatherings such […]

During the three-year period 2021–2023, an average of 726 new cases of prostate cancer were recorded each year, said the Minister of Health, Neophytos Charalambides, in his speech at the Europa Uomo Cyprus Press Conference for the European Prostate Cancer Awareness and Information Day, which began with the screening of a relevant video and a minute of silence in memory of its volunteers, Popi Christoforou and Father Ioannis, priest of Kyperounda…
